# Transform Valentine's Day into Mathematical Innovation!

**Watch your K-2 students become mathematical inventors** as they design and build heart-shaped tools that solve real math problems! This comprehensive resource combines beloved Valentine themes with authentic engineering design to create unforgettable mathematical learning experiences.

## What Makes This Resource Special:

**5 Progressive Math Invention Projects** that build mathematical thinking:

- **Heart-Shaped Counting Machines:** Design tools for counting and addition practice using Valentine manipulatives

- **Valentine Pattern Generators:** Engineer devices that create mathematical patterns with heart shapes and colors

- **Love Letter Geometry Sorters:** Build sorting systems for geometric classification and spatial reasoning

- **Valentine Measurement Workshops:** Invent custom measuring tools using heart units and standard measurements

- **Kindness Calculation Machines:** Create systems that combine mathematics with social-emotional learning

**Mathematical Engineering Focus** - students learn that math is a creative tool for invention and real-world problem-solving!
